Authenticity Check for Hermes Bags
One of the first steps in authenticating a Hermes bag is to closely examine the craftsmanship and materials used. Hermes bags are known for their impeccable quality, with every detail meticulously crafted. Check the stitching, hardware, and overall construction of the bag for any signs of poor workmanship, such as uneven stitching or loose threads.
Additionally, pay attention to the materials used in the bag. Hermes bags are typically made from high-quality leathers, such as Togo, Clemence, and Epsom. These leathers have a luxurious feel and distinctive grain pattern that sets them apart from cheaper imitations. Genuine Hermes bags also feature high-quality hardware, such as gold or palladium-plated zippers and clasps.
Hermes Authentication Check by CH
Hermes bags are known for their meticulous attention to detail, including the presence of serial codes and blind stamps. These markings are unique to each Hermes bag and can help authenticate its origin. A Hermes blind stamp is a small embossed mark located on the interior of the bag, typically near the top edge. This stamp includes a letter that denotes the year of production and a craftsman's code.
In addition to the blind stamp, Hermes bags also feature a serial code that is printed on a leather tab inside the bag. This code includes a letter and a number that indicates the year of production and the craftsman's identification number. By cross-referencing these markings with Hermes authentication databases or consulting with experts, you can verify the authenticity of a Hermes bag.
Genuine Leather Hermes Bag
One of the hallmarks of a genuine Hermes bag is the quality of the leather used. Hermes sources the finest leathers from around the world, ensuring that each bag is crafted from premium materials. When authenticating a Hermes bag, pay close attention to the feel and appearance of the leather. Genuine Hermes leather has a luxurious texture and a distinct smell that sets it apart from synthetic materials.
In addition, examine the grain pattern of the leather. Hermes bags are known for their unique grain patterns, which vary depending on the type of leather used. Togo leather, for example, has a fine grain pattern with a slightly raised texture, while Clemence leather has a softer, pebbled appearance. Familiarize yourself with the different types of Hermes leather to better identify the authenticity of a Hermes bag.
Hermes Kelly Bag: The Real Authentication
The Hermes Kelly bag, named after the actress and Princess of Monaco, Grace Kelly, is one of the most iconic and sought-after handbags in the world. Authenticating a Hermes Kelly bag requires a keen eye for detail and an understanding of the bag's design features. Look for the signature trapezoidal shape, top handle, and distinctive turn-lock closure that are synonymous with the Hermes Kelly bag.
When examining a Hermes Kelly bag for authenticity, pay attention to the craftsmanship and hardware details. Genuine Hermes Kelly bags feature high-quality stitching, precise hardware engraving, and a symmetrical design. The interior of the bag should also be meticulously finished, with no loose threads or unfinished edges. By closely inspecting these details, you can confidently authenticate a Hermes Kelly bag.
